Tederic On Show NEO-E320 All Electric Injection Molding Machine at PlastImagen 2025

Turn-key IML Solutions

At PlastImagen 2025, Tederic on showed their 320T all electric injection molding machine NEO-E320 with turn-key solution of 4 cavities cups which the parts picked and stacked by a high speed 3 axis servo injection robot. The Tederic NEO-EII series all electric injection molding machine provide a choice of clamping force from 60T~1400T.

The NEO-EII series all electric injection molding machine of Tederic is designed with the concept of extreme purity, pioneer and high performance, and excellent technological innovation. With full servo motor precision control and a repeat positioning accuracy up to 0.01mm, the NEO-EII all electric injection molding machine will provide the plastic plant owners a superb electric technology and rich application experience.

The solution on show PlastImagen 2025 with NEO-E320 is a 4 cavities cups production with high speed injection robot, as a high speed all electric injection molding machine, the NEO-E320 is also an ideal choice for the production of IML Yogurt congainers. With more and more manufacturers of injection molding machine joint the competition of all electric injection molding machine manufacturing, it's also now a price-smart solution for the clean production of IML Yogurt cups in a clean room. SWITEK BLOOD TUBES PACKING SOLUTIONS

About SWITEK Laboratory Consumable Testing Tubes Collecting Solutions
blood tubes collecting solution

SWITEK laboratory consumable testing tubes collecting solutions is an integrated automation system of the laboratory consumable testing tubes injection molding which include the testing tubes picking robot, testing tubes sorting, collecting and have them loaded in plastic bags for vacuum and packing.

Parameters of SWITEK Testing Tubes Collecting System

  • Injection Molding Machine: 2500~4000kN High Speed Injection Molding Machine
  • Mold Layout Design: 32/48/64 Cavities
  • Injection Cycle Time: 8s
  • In Mold Time: 2s ±15%
  • Installation Dimension: 3000mm (L) x 2000mm (W) x 2200mm (H)

    The detailed functional units of the testing tubes collecting sysstem:
  • (1) Box Loading Robot: Pick the sorted testing tubes and load them in the box.
  • (2) Testing Tubes Receiving Arm: Receive the testing tubes from the picking arm (6).
  • (3) & (5) Box Sliding Conveyor: Have the tubes collecting box moved to the right position to be loaded.
  • (6) Testing Tubes Picking Arm: To pick the testing tubes from the injection molding machine.
  • (7) Testing Tubes Collecting Station: The testing tubes receiving robot will drop the testing tubes here to be slided down to be sorted for box loading.
  • (8) Testing Tubes Sliding Tubes: To protect the testing tubes from scratching in dropping.
  • (9) Sensors: The sensors to check the availability of the testing tubes.
  • (10) Conveyor: Conveyor of the sorted testing tubes to be picked by the box loading robot.
